常见问题

什么是FileCatalyst?

FileCatalyst如何加速文件传输?

On-the-Fly压缩如何帮助FileCatalyst?

FileCatalyst使用哪些协议来传输文件?

FileCatalyst中使用的基于UDP的协议是什么?

为什么FileCatalyst UDP协议比常规FTP,HTTP或其他基于TCP的传输更好?

FileCatalyst如何使用多个TCP流来传输文件?

什么是三角洲转移?它有何帮助?

FileCatalyst与WAN加速器设备相比如何?

FileCatalyst可以与WAN加速器一起使用吗?

为什么FileCatalyst比其他基于UDP的文件传输解决方案更好?

1。 什么是FileCatalyst?

FileCatalyst是一种软件解决方案,支持客户端/服务器架构来传输大型文件。 它是一种纯软件解决方案,可以避免添加特殊硬件或进行带宽升级。 无论网络条件如何,FileCatalyst都使用先进技术提供极高的吞吐量。 最后,即使存在高网络延迟或数据包丢失,这也会导致远程位置之间的文件传输速度更快。

2。 FileCatalyst如何加速文件传输?

FileCatalyst使用多种技术来产生出色的结果; 在许多情况下,产生的传输速度比实际线速度快。 这些技术包括:

  • FileCatalyst基于UDP的协议:FileCatalyst使用正在申请专利的基于UDP的协议,当网络上出现高延迟或丢包时,该协议可以更快地传输大型数据集
  • 即时压缩:FileCatalyst实时压缩它通过网络发送的数据,这意味着在每次传输的开始或结束时都没有耗时的压缩或解压缩。 文件大小可能会减少50%或更多,从而产生超出线速的传输错觉。
  • 多个TCP流:在无法使用UDP的情况下,FileCatalyst可以通过运行多个并发TCP流的传输以及即时压缩来实现一定程度的加速。
  • Delta Transfers:如果文件自上次传输后已更改,则FileCatalyst只能发送文件的“增量”(增量差异),而不是完整地重新发送。

3。 On-the-Fly压缩如何帮助FileCatalyst?

即时压缩允许数字文件在发送时减小尺寸。 它使用与WinZip,Gzip和其他压缩实用程序相同的原则。 FileCatalyst的不同之处在于,在传输文件时会发生压缩,从而节省了准备时间。 当文件到达收件人时,它们将被解压缩并自动以原始格式存储。

使用动态压缩需要较少的设置和拆卸,这在传输大量文件时变得非常重要。 想象一下尝试发送1,000文件所涉及的开销,因为每个文件都是由服务器单独创建和关闭的。 标准压缩技术会中断数据流,增加总时间并使文件传输速度变慢。 发送一个大型存档时,只涉及一个设置和拆卸,这大大加快了整个传输过程。

4。 FileCatalyst使用哪些协议来传输文件?

FileCatalyst使用UDP协议进行数据传输,使用TCP进行控制命令和重传请求。 FileCatalyst还提供了一种辅助防火墙友好的传输方法,通过打开多个并发数据流来增强TCP的性能。

5。 FileCatalyst中使用的基于UDP的协议是什么?

FileCatalyst中使用的基于UDP的协议是专有的。 它是一种高效,正在申请专利的重传和拥塞控制机制,可为UDP添加可靠性层。 数据流可以实现全线速度,并且具有极低的0.25%开销。

6。 为什么FileCatalyst UDP协议比常规FTP,HTTP或其他基于TCP的传输更好?

FTP和HTTP都使用TCP作为传输协议。 TCP的固有特性使其非常容易受到网络延迟和数据包丢失的影响。 即使在相对稳定的网络上,TCP吞吐量也总是低于实际可用的线路速度。 例如,在丢包率为3%且延迟为45 ms的T0.1网络(10 Mbps)上,FTP传输的峰值仅为30 Mbps。 与此形成鲜明对比的是,FileCatalyst产生的44 Mbps吞吐量略低于最大可用线速度。 当网络状况恶化到2%数据包丢失和150 ms延迟时,预计FTP传输将以450 Kbps或实际可用带宽的1%执行。 FileCatalyst维持其44Mbps吞吐量。 要查看FTP与FileCatalyst的其他可比指标,请单击 查看更多.

7。 FileCatalyst如何使用多个TCP流来传输文件?

多个线程不是按顺序读取和发送文件,而是从文件中读取并通过它们自己的TCP流传输片段。 这些部件通过相同数量的接收器线程在运行中接收和重新组装。 在重建期间没有延迟,因为使用随机访问来编写片段。 可以调整流的数量以实现期望的吞吐量。 当网络降级处于合理水平时,这种传输文件的方法是有效的。 由于必须运行大量并发线程才能维持高速,因此该方法不像FileCatalyst基于UDP的传输那样可扩展。

8。 什么是三角洲转移?它有何帮助?

FileCatalyst支持高级“增量”传输算法。 完整传输文件后,任何新修订都只需要发送这些增量更改,而不需要整个新文件。 例如,想象一下一个大型数据库文件。 有时,仅更改数据库的一小部分,例如单个名称或位置字段。 FileCatalyst将这些修改计算为“增量”,并且仅传输新数据。 在目标位置,FileCatalyst自动修改更改,使文件与源同步。 这样可确保将带宽使用率保持在最低水平,并产生非常高的有效吞吐量。

9。 FileCatalyst与WAN加速器设备相比如何?

当必须在组织的所有WAN节点之间加速所有数据时,WAN加速器设备可能是一个很好的解决方案。 这样的设备可以很好地加速CIFS,电子邮件和Web,以及提高FTP性能的合理工作 - 提供的网络条件并不太严格。 如果问题不仅限于文件传输,则WAN加速器可能是数据基础架构的重要组成部分。

相比之下,FileCatalyst只加速文件传输; 但它比其他任何产品都做得更好。 基于软件,FileCatalyst非常易于部署,不需要对网络进行物理更改。 无论链接条件如何,FileCatalyst都可以保证全线速度或更高速度。 基于FileCatalyst Server的定价模型使转移方案为多对一或一对多时更具成本效益。 您只需一个许可证即可部署一台服务器并支持数千名最终用户。

此外,FileCatalyst软件套件提供了许多应用程序级功能,这些功能在使用其他3rd方文件传输应用程序和WAN设备时根本不存在。 功能和带宽调度,自动重新连接和恢复,动态压缩和增量传输等功能。 没有其他文件传输软件能够比FileCatalyst更好地实现最大化实际数据吞吐量。

10。 FileCatalyst可以与WAN加速器一起使用吗?

是。 FileCatalyst可以添加WAN加速器的值。 WAN加速器使用适用于广泛任务的技术,简化大区域内的所有网络流量。 另一方面,FileCatalyst使用专为此工作构建的专有技术,最佳地优化文件传输。 当结合使用时,两者实际上可以相互补充。

11。 为什么FileCatalyst比其他基于UDP的文件传输解决方案更好?

使用UDP进行传输的文件传输解决方案缺乏FileCatalyst的速度和可扩展性。 由于UDP本身的性质,数据包传输本身并不能保证。 所有基于UDP的解决方案都必须跟踪单个数据包以确保交付。 如果数据包丢失,则必须将消息发送回发送方以请求重新传输。 如果不能有效地处理该过程,则当分组丢失高时性能将显着降低。 FileCatalyst正在申请专利的技术可确保数据的持续流动,在继续操作之前永不等待确认,并始终与新数据同时重新传输。 数据流是恒定的 - 以链接的速度。

此外,FileCatalyst广泛的应用程序列表使竞争更加激烈。 没有其他应用程序将UDP传输与动态压缩和增量传输结合在一起。 FileCatalyst是唯一具有Java小程序的应用程序,可用于基于Web的传输,而无需安装。 它是唯一可以在安装Java VM的所有平台上运行的应用程序,而无需特殊的构建,也不需要其他应用程序的所有“陷阱”。 FileCatalyst是唯一无需开箱即用即可填充管道的应用程序。